Nebula Research & Development LLC Establishment Labs Holdings Inc. Transaction History
Nebula Research & Development LLC
- $1.08 Trillion
- Q1 2025
A detailed history of Nebula Research & Development LLC transactions in Establishment Labs Holdings Inc. stock. As of the latest transaction made, Nebula Research & Development LLC holds 12,676 shares of ESTA stock, worth $537,589. This represents 0.05% of its overall portfolio holdings.
Number of Shares
12,676
Previous 9,556
32.65%
Holding current value
$537,589
Previous $440 Million
17.49%
% of portfolio
0.05%
Previous 0.05%
Shares
5 transactions
Others Institutions Holding ESTA
# of Institutions
150Shares Held
27.1MCall Options Held
1.14MPut Options Held
590K-
Jw Asset Management, LLC Armonk, NY3.09MShares$131 Million73.4% of portfolio
-
Rtw Investments, LP New York, NY2.58MShares$110 Million1.73% of portfolio
-
Brown Advisory Inc2.29MShares$97.3 Million0.14% of portfolio
-
Capital Research Global Investors Los Angeles, CA1.95MShares$82.5 Million0.02% of portfolio
-
Nantahala Capital Management, LLC New Canaan, CT1.77MShares$75.2 Million3.26% of portfolio
About ESTABLISHMENT LABS HOLDINGS INC.
- Ticker ESTA
- Exchange NASDAQ
- Sector Healthcare
- Industry Medical Devices
- Shares Outstandng 24,268,500
- Market Cap $1.03B
- Description
- Establishment Labs Holdings Inc., a medical technology company, manufactures and markets medical devices for aesthetic and reconstructive plastic surgery. The company primarily offers silicone gel-filled breast implants under Motiva Implants brand name. It also provides Motiva Ergonomix and Motiva Ergonomix2 gravity sensitive round soft silicone...